Clapham High Street station simplifies ticketing with accessible ticket machines ready for use. Though there isn’t a traditional ticket office, purchasing and collecting tickets online is straightforward and convenient. Smartcards are not issued here, so ensure to have valid tickets beforehand. While the station provides visible customer help points and information screens, it's important to note that there are no staffed helplines at the station.
Accessibility is somewhat limited at Clapham High Street with Category C classification, indicating no step-free access. Also, there are no accessible toilets or ramps for train access. While seating is available on both platforms, waiting rooms and lounges are absent, meaning you'll want to plan your stay accordingly when traveling.
Clapham High Street is a utilitarian station, and as such, lacks facilities like refreshment areas, shops, or public Wi-Fi. However, its strategic location offers excellent external amenities. The station is enveloped by an array of local cafes and shops, perfect for preparing for your journey or grabbing a quick bite.
For those needing to continue their journey beyond the station, there are several transport links. Bus stops nearby provide easy connectivity, with routes available for both southbound and northbound services. You're conveniently located a mere three-minute walk from Clapham North London Underground station if you need an underground ride on the Northern line. Additionally, you can organize taxi services in advance through reliable platforms like Addison Lee and Gett.

While Melksham Train Station doesn't have a ticket office, it provides ticket machines for easy collection of pre-purchased tickets. The machines are accessible, ensuring everyone can get their tickets hassle-free. For those needing additional assistance, a help point staffed with friendly personnel is available, though there’s no dedicated customer information service. It's also comforting to know that the station is equipped with CCTV for security.
Convenience and accessibility go hand-in-hand at Melksham Station. It's a step-free access station, making it easy for travelers with reduced mobility to navigate. While there are no ticket barriers or waiting rooms, there is a seating area for comfort while waiting for your train. Keep in mind, there's a lack of toilets, refreshment facilities, and shops on-site, so planning ahead is advisable. For those with bicycles, there are sheltered stands available on Platform 1.

The station also provides a rail replacement service from the car park and printed bus travel information for seamless onward travel.
If you're planning to explore further or need alternative transport, Melksham Station has got you covered. While there's no dedicated bus service mentioned directly at the station, you can access comprehensive journey information from the National Rail website. Taxis, car hires, and other transport forms are easily arranged from the town center. For those driving to the station, the car park is open 24/7, offering 10 spaces free of charge, though none are specifically marked as accessible spaces.
